By Pete Earley. "How One Man's Tragedy Helped Unlock the Deadliest Secrets of the World's Most Terrifying Killers." After a terrible accident as a teenager, Tony Ciaglia started writing to notorious mass murderers, finding common ground somehow in the traumatic brain injury he'd suffered. From a lauded genre author.
